Differentiate the following w.r.t.x:

log (sec 3x+ tan 3x)

योग
Advertisements

उत्तर

Let y = log (sec 3x+ tan 3x)
Differentiating w.r.t. x, we get
`"dy"/"dx" = "d"/"dx"[log (sec 3x+ tan 3x)]`

= `(1)/(sec 3x + tan 3x)."d"/"dx"(sec 3x + tan 3x)`

= `(1)/(sec 3x + tan 3x) xx ["d"/"dx"(sec3x) + "d"/"dx"(tan 3x)]`

= `(1)/(sec 3x + tan 3x) xx [sec3x tan3x. "d"/"dx"(3x) + sec^2 3x."d"/"dx"(3x)]`

= `(1)/(sec 3x + tan 3x) xx [sec 3x tan3x xx 3 + sec^2 3x xx 3]`

= `(3sec 3x(tan3x + sec3x))/(sec 3x + tan3x)`
= 3sec 3x
